The alterations were underneath the Mortgage Disclosure Improvement Act of 2008, that took result last July 30, 2009. This act mainly requires lenders to administer ample time to shoppers thus they will run through every detail of the loan contract efficiently. Both parties are enabled to instigate transparency even throughout the initial stage of the loan application. Therefore all throughout the dealing, both the lender and the consumer are additional familiarized with their obligations and expectations. The delinquency rates may then be combated successfully, which advantages each parties.
As of so far, there are four main areas where the changes in TILA affect the borrower and the lender. Early disclosure is foremost among the advantages for the client. Lenders are required to give initial disclosure at intervals three business days with the assurance that the Good Religion Estimate and Truth in Lending documentation were already given. These statements must include the Annual Share Rate one week before closing the deal. There is currently conjointly space for adjustments through the re-disclosure process. If the APR increases or decreases a lot of than the tolerance of 0.a hundred twenty five % of the first rate, the borrower has the right to request for a replacement TIL to be sent. Another three days are added to the waiting amount before the loan is closed. Additionally among this era, the client now has the liberty whether or not to decline or finally settle for the terms and conditions of the contract. Conversely during the transaction, the lender has no privilege to collect fees aside from the need of credit reporting.
And lastly, through the aforementioned details, the borrower is empowered as all disclosure documents are obligatory to contain this statement, “You’re not needed to finish this agreement just because you’ve got received the disclosures or signed a loan application. You may not be tied to the deal if you are not proud of the terms or conditions prior to the closing.”
